Studies In The Behavior Of Certain Cyclic Olefins Toward Divalent Platinum And Palladium, Ernest Sam Juljian
Studies In The Behavior Of Certain Cyclic Olefins Toward Divalent Platinum And Palladium, Ernest Sam Juljian
University of the Pacific Theses and Dissertations
The initial program of study for consideration was the extension of cyclooctatetraene complexation to other metals of the transition group. Compounds of (COT) with iron, cobalt, chromium, molybdenum, and tungsten which have been reported in the literature involve carbonyl ligands simultaneously as (COT)M(CO)x with x = 2,3----; only Ag(I) as AgN03 adducts are known. Rhodium (I) is said to form an unstable dimer while ruthenium (I) forms a polymer. (COT)Pt(II) chloride, bromide and iodide have been reported but only the iodide has been studied; only (COT)PdCl2 has been reported recently. It was further conceived that substituted (COT) would …

High Frequency Titrations In Liquid Ammonia, Jack Charles Hileman
High Frequency Titrations In Liquid Ammonia, Jack Charles Hileman
University of the Pacific Theses and Dissertations
An extensive literature has been established on the use of high frequency conductometric methods in chemical analysis and research. The fact that the instruments respond to chemical changes without having electrodes immersed in the reacting solutions has attracted the attention of many investigators. Until the last few years, practically all of the investigations were concerned with aqueous solutions, with the exception of measurements of dielectric constants.
There seemed no logical reason for not extending the use of the high frequency instruments to the study of Bronsted acid-base reactions, organic syntheses, rates of reaction, and the other commonly studied aspects of …
High Temperature Adsorption Studies On Solid Adsorbents, Julian Joseph Hamerski
High Temperature Adsorption Studies On Solid Adsorbents, Julian Joseph Hamerski
University of the Pacific Theses and Dissertations
It has been found that there exist certain crystalline aluminosilicates which provide regular net-works of channels with diameters no bigger than those of molecules. Such crystals can act as sieves (thus the name "molecular sieves" now marketed by the Linde Air Products Company) and bring about a separation of molecular species by occluding small molecules while not adsorbing larger molecules or molecules with shapes that do not "fit."
The aluminosilicates were termed zeolites first by Baron Cronstedt (1) some 200 years ago. He observed that certain mineral crystals, when heated, appeared to melt and to boil at the same time. …
A New Approach To General Chemistry Laboratory In College (With) A Laboratory Manual For General Chemistry, Constantine G. Vlassis
A New Approach To General Chemistry Laboratory In College (With) A Laboratory Manual For General Chemistry, Constantine G. Vlassis
University of the Pacific Theses and Dissertations
Statement of the problem. This study was carried out to determine: (1) what advantages a laboratory-centered general chemistry course might have over the conventional laboratory course, and (2) whether improved understanding of laboratory work leads to better learning of chemistry. The four following questions were raised in connection with the study or this problem:
- What is the need for a laboratory-centered course?
- What has been done in the past to meet this need?
- Can students learn chemistry more effectively in a laboratory-centered course as compared to the conventional course?
- Is a laboratory-centered course to be preferred over the conventional course …
